Disability shower installation services involve the design and setup of accessible shower units tailored to meet specific mobility needs.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. The process often requires careful planning to ensure the shower area accommodates wheelchairs or walkers, providing a more independent bathing experience for individuals with limited mobility. Local service providers focus on creating functional, safe, and comfortable shower environments that support daily routines and improve overall quality of life.
This service addresses common challenges faced by individuals with disabilities or mobility issues, such as difficulty entering standard showers, risk of slips and falls, and the need for additional support features. Installing a disability-friendly shower can significantly reduce the risk of accidents during bathing and minimize reliance on caregivers. It also allows for easier access and maneuverability within the shower space, making daily hygiene routines more manageable.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. For example, a basic accessible shower might be around $1,500, while custom features can increase the price. Costs vary based on local contractor rates and specific requirements.
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ations generally fall between $500 and $2,000. This includes options like low-threshold bases, grab bars, and non-slip flooring. Higher-end materials or specialized fixtures can add to the overall expense.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for professional installation typically range from $800 to $2,500. Rates depend on the project's scope, the contractor's fees, and regional pricing differences, with more complex setups requiring additional labor time.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for disability shower installation services usually span from $2,800 to $6,500. Exact pricing varies based on the size, features, and local contractor rates, with detailed estimates available from local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
